This kind of rambunctious, coercive and cool movie style is still very useful. It is hard to guess how the director understands Japanese Bushido. Personally, I feel that the director regards this as a simple symbol, which seems to be about the spirit of Bushido. I haven't elaborated too much. Of course, I don't know the spirit of Bushido. It's just from the performance in the movie. The director is using the mysterious power from the East to represent the character of the character. Loneliness, loyalty and calm ability are powerful. , From the action of closing the gun, to the in-depth and concise life style, the loyal attitude, and the strong sense of justice (revenge for the poached bear), it seems that the protagonist needs a spiritual source, and the mysterious power from the East seems to be A good choice, he is as erratic as GHOST, and as loyal as DOG. No matter how different the protagonist is from American culture, as long as the answer is that the protagonist has learned the mysterious ability from the East, everything It seems reasonable
